A Chinese blue glazed vase, meiping
19TH CENTURY
Of baluster shape, with a spreading lower section rising to the broad and high shoulder, below the waisted neck and lipped rim, the exterior covered with a deep mottled blue orange-peel glaze stopping neatly around the unglazed footrim, the interior and base covered with a pale celadon glaze
7¾in. (19.7cm.) high
